Mary Thompson, age 98, passed away Tuesday, June 5, 2018 at Maritime Gardens in Manitowoc, Wisconsin.

She was born May 15, 1920, the eldest child of Albert and Mary Shimek. Mary was born in Manitowoc, Wisconsin and at an early age the family moved to Grimms. She attended Grimms Public School and graduated from Reedsville High School with the Class of 1938. On February 1, 1940 she married Joel Thompson and they ran the home farm for many years. Mary was active in her church and taught Sunday School for many years along with being a member of the Altar Guild and other church organizations.
